and that brings me to the point that really needs to be brought up – of all the personal protection bullshit efforts that are out there the one that was really lacking was education. you can tell people to wear a mask, but unless it comes with instructions, it doesn’t do shit worth of good.

it seems like it shouldn’t be necessary, but…

…one of the biggest problems with this world in general is people assuming a level of general knowledge in the populace that simply doesn’t exist, and this isn’t new. i remember having to explain to folks i’d train to do star tickets tech support (2000-2003 on the resume) to never assume people knew shit about shit because the step you skip assuming people “just know” will be the missing brick that causes the wall to crumble. likewise with tattoo folk currently. i remember asking an artist if she had, up front, let the lady know that lettering that small on the side of her finger would heal like shit and i got back, “c’mon, sean, EVERYBODY knows that!”. but they don’t. they saw a two day old one on pinterest and it looked fucking fantastic. and as tattoos are “forever”, that means what they saw on pinterest is FORVER…that’s just logical thinking in the eyes of the public, ya know? you saw a tattoo, and tattoos are forever, hence it looks like that FORVER.

but…not so much. so never assume what you think “everybody know”, because pal o’ mine, they don’t know shit.

“what the american people don’t know is what makes them the american people” – dan akroyd, tommy boy (1995)

so people assuming the average joe knows how to wear a surgical mask doesn’t mean they do. just like how they know they should wear gloves before they go in the grocery store, but don’t know they shouldn’t keep them on to reach for their wallet, keys, or phone. i know when you do you just basically smeared the store across those items because i work in the tattoo industry and am well versed in cross contamination – but the public doesn’t know that shit, and assuming they do doesn’t shows both the public’s ignorance AND the ignorance of the person making the assumption.
